What are the most common Nissan repair issues you see for vehicles in the Millington, MD area?

In our local climate, Nissan CVT (Continuously Variable Transmission) issues are prevalent, often signaled by hesitation or humming. We also frequently address brake corrosion from salted winter roads and suspension wear from rural Kent County road conditions. Regular checks on these systems can prevent major repairs.

When should I seek service for my Nissan's CVT transmission specifically?

Seek service immediately if you notice shuddering during acceleration, overheating, or unusual whining noises. Given the stop-and-go nature of routes like MD-313 and the strain of summer heat, proactive fluid changes every 60,000 miles are a critical local maintenance step to avoid failure.

Are repair costs for Nissans generally higher at dealerships versus independent shops in Millington?

Typically, independent repair shops in the Millington area offer more competitive labor rates than dealerships, which are farther away in places like Dover or Middletown. However, always request a detailed written estimate upfront to compare, as part costs can be similar for genuine Nissan components.

What local driving conditions in Kent County should influence my Nissan's maintenance schedule?

The mix of rural gravel backroads and highway driving can accelerate wear on tires, shocks, and undercarriage components. We recommend more frequent inspections of suspension and alignment, especially after winter, to handle potholes and uneven surfaces common on local roads like Augustine Herman Highway.
